Avançar para o conteúdo principal
BlogFerramentas de desenvolvimentoPese as suas opções de monitorização de nuvens

Pese as suas opções de monitorização de nuvens

Pese as suas opções de monitorização de nuvens

Nas redes dos dias de hoje, o tempo de funcionamento interessa. Qualquer falha nas operações normais pode conduzir a perdas de dinheiro e de tempo, por isso quando planeia o seu ambiente cloud, lembre-se que precisará de uma forma de estar informado sobre o estado dos seus sistemas. Esta necessidade por informações contínuas sobre o estado do sistema significa que a configuração cloud não fica completa sem uma solução de monitorização robusta e bem integrada. Uma boa solução de monitorização ajudará a marcar problemas antes que aconteçam e até enviará alertas ao staff de TI se algo estiver mal. 

A maioria dos fornecedores de cloud disponibilizam alguma forma de monitorização integrada, mas interessa estudar as suas opções e decidir em alternativa o que é melhor para o seu ambiente. Uma escolha importante é a de decidir um modelo de integração cloud para a monitorização da sua solução. As opções comuns incluem:

  • Código aberto: Ferramentas gratuitas suportadas pelo fornecedor cloud e disponíveis universalmente a todos os utilizadores.
  • Terceiros: Soluções comerciais integradas com o ambiente cloud através de uma parceria pré-acordada com um fornecedor cloud.
  • Proprietário: Serviços de monitorização incluídos exclusivamente na rede cloud do fornecedor.

As soluções de monitorização de nuvens de fonte aberta têm tipicamente o custo global mais baixo. As principais alternativas de monitorização de código-fonte aberto, tais como Prometheus são muito empreendedoras, com características tais como uma linguagem de consulta a bordo, um modelo de dados multidimensional, e uma estreita integração com o Grafana ambiente de visualização. Porque estão livremente disponíveis, as soluções de monitorização de nuvens de código aberto são bem conhecidas de muitos profissionais de TI e oferecem uma curva de aprendizagem mais curta.

Se as opções de código aberto disponíveis não disponibilizarem as funcionalidades que procura, as soluções de monitorização de terceiros são uma alternativa eficaz. Muitas soluções de terceiros existem porque disponibilizam funcionalidades que não estão disponíveis com as alternativas principais de código aberto. Ferramentas como o Circonus e o Panopta, por exemplo, disponibilizam algumas funcionalidades avançadas e fornecem uma integração mais extensa numa maior variedade de plataformas e tipos de dispositivos.  

Muitos vendedores de grandes nuvens oferecem as suas próprias soluções de monitorização proprietárias. Por vezes estas ferramentas são incorporadas directamente no ambiente, e por vezes são comercializadas como produtos separados, tais como o CloudWatch, que é propriedade e operado por Amazon.

As ferramentas proprietárias disponibilizadas pelos fornecedores de cloud têm um elevado nível de integração no ambiente do fornecedor de cloud. Ainda assim. uma desvantagem importante das soluções de proprietário é que isso representa uma forma de lock-in do fornecedor. Assume-se que irá desenvolver todos os seus negócios com um fornecedor de cloud, não só agora como no futuro. Se desejar escolher diversidade mais tarde à medida que as suas necessidades mudam e o mercado evolui, perde a oportunidade para uma solução unificada. As ferramentas de proprietário dos grandes fornecedores de cloud também às vezes sofrem grandes complicações do mercado de cloud, tais como custos mais elevados e menos atenção ao serviço individualizado ao cliente.

A sua escolha de uma solução de monitorização de nuvens depende das necessidades do seu ambiente e dos seus planos para o futuro. Suponha que sabe que está num só lugar e não espera que o seu ambiente sofra alterações significativas. Nesse caso, uma solução proprietária poderia ser uma alternativa viável se já estiver 100% investido num grande fornecedor de nuvens como Amazon. Mas o DevOps tem tudo a ver com flexibilidade e transformação contínua. Se implementar a monitorização de nuvens num ambiente DevOps, planeie com antecedência a portabilidade com uma solução de monitorização de código aberto ou de terceiros para se manter ágil e maximizar as suas opções futuras.

Comentários

Deixe uma resposta

O seu endereço de correio electrónico não será publicado. Os campos obrigatórios estão marcados com *